MR. JUSTICE MORAN delivered the opinion of the court:
Ralph Walden, claimant, sought a workmen's compensation award for injuries he allegedly received as the result of a fall down steps outside a hotel in Cleveland, Ohio, on March 31, 1976. An Industrial Commission arbitrator denied claimant any compensation, finding that claimant had failed to prove that he sustained accidental injuries arising out of and in the course of his employment...
